Gornji Grad ("Upper Town") is a city district in the center of Osijek, Croatia.
The most famous attractions of Osijek are located in Gornji Grad, such as Co-cathedral, Ante Starčević Square, Croatian National Theatre, County palace and Pedestrian bridge.
Day of the city district is on 29 June, on feast of Saint Peter and Paul.
